Lines Matching refs:pszSymbol

99 static DECLCALLBACK(int) supLoadModuleResolveImport(RTLDRMOD hLdrMod, const char *pszModule, const char *pszSymbol, unsigned uSymbol, RTUINTPTR *pValue, void *pvUser);
141 * @param pszSymbol Symbol name, NULL if uSymbol should be used.
142 * @param uSymbol Symbol ordinal, ~0 if pszSymbol should be used.
147 const char *pszSymbol, unsigned uSymbol, RTUINTPTR *pValue, void *pvUser)
168 if (pszSymbol < (const char*)0x10000)
170 AssertMsgFailed(("%s is importing by ordinal (ord=%d)\n", pvUser, (int)(uintptr_t)pszSymbol));
179 if (!strncmp(pszSymbol, RT_STR_TUPLE("SUPR0$")))
180 pszSymbol += sizeof("SUPR0$") - 1;
190 if (!SUPR3GetSymbolR0((void *)g_pvVMMR0, pszSymbol, &pvValue))
202 if (!strcmp(pFunc->szName, pszSymbol))
213 if ( pszSymbol
216 && !strcmp(pszSymbol, "g_SUPGlobalInfoPage")
238 && !RTStrCmp(s_apszConvSyms[i + 1], pszSymbol))
257 AssertLogRelMsgFailed(("%s is importing %s which we couldn't find\n", pvUser, pszSymbol));
279 static DECLCALLBACK(int) supLoadModuleCalcSizeCB(RTLDRMOD hLdrMod, const char *pszSymbol, unsigned uSymbol, RTUINTPTR Value, void *pvUser)
282 if ( pszSymbol != NULL
283 && *pszSymbol
287 pArgs->cbStrings += strlen(pszSymbol) + 1;
307 static DECLCALLBACK(int) supLoadModuleCreateTabsCB(RTLDRMOD hLdrMod, const char *pszSymbol, unsigned uSymbol, RTUINTPTR Value, void *pvUser)
310 if ( pszSymbol != NULL
311 && *pszSymbol
318 size_t cbCopy = strlen(pszSymbol) + 1;
319 memcpy(pArgs->psz, pszSymbol, cbCopy);
599 SUPR3DECL(int) SUPR3GetSymbolR0(void *pvImageBase, const char *pszSymbol, void **ppvValue)
621 size_t cchSymbol = strlen(pszSymbol);
624 memcpy(Req.u.In.szSymbol, pszSymbol, cchSymbol + 1);